One advantage of multi-spectral analysis over an X-ray machine is that it can analyze pigments and materials in addition to providing information not visible to the naked eye. This means that multi-spectral analysis can reveal hidden details and information about the composition of artwork that would not be possible with an X-ray machine alone. Additionally, multi-spectral analysis is useful for examining large art pieces that are difficult to move, as it can be done on-site without the need for transportation. Lastly, multi-spectral analysis has the capability to see below the surface of artwork, providing insights into layers, alterations, and even hidden artwork beneath the visible surface.
